A 24-YEAR-OLD man has been jailed for 20 months after he terrified families by brandishing a realistic-looking black handgun in a Keighley street.

Firearms officers and the police helicopter were scrambled after Jonathon Warren shouted threats and kicked at a house door while holding a replica Jericho 941 pistol, a weapon developed by Israel Weapon Industries.

People feared the gun was real when drunken Warren caused a disturbance in the middle of the night in Third Avenue, Bradford Crown Court heard today.

He pleaded guilty to possession of an imitation firearm with intent to cause fear of violence at 1am on April 7.

Prosecutor Stephanie Hancock said James Walker and his sister Victoria watched on CCTV from inside the house as Warren banged at the door, shouting: "If you don't open up I am going to kill Craig."

Miss Hancock said this was a reference to a former partner of Warren's.

One brave neighbour, Lisa Lee, persuaded Warren to leave the street.

At first, she believed the gun was real, and warned him there were children in the house, but he showed her it was imitation.

After a 40-minute search, Warren, of Church Lane, Pudsey, was traced to his then address in nearby Foster Road and arrested after a struggle.

The gun was found by the police hidden behind a panel beneath the cooker.

Miss Hancock said the BB pistol was not capable of being fired that night.

Stephen Wood, barrister for Warren, said he was ashamed of getting drunk and frightening innocent members of the public.

"He allows grievances to build up in a totally inappropriate way," Mr Wood said.

Warren had problems of his own and walked away when bravely confronted by Miss Lee.

The gun was unloaded and the gas cartridge spent.

Judge Robert Bartfield told Warren: "Anybody who takes a gun out on to the streets, or an imitation gun, and causes people to fear for their lives, will always receive a custodial sentence."

Warren was seeking retribution with Mr Walker, after he had got drunk.

Miss Walker thought it was a real gun and feared they would all be killed.
